On Wednesday, Real Madrid and Braga will play in Group C of the UEFA Champions League. The action is available on Paramount+. After three matchdays, Real Madrid, the 14-time European champion, leads Group C with nine points. Braga is now in third place with three points, but they should be feeling quite confident after defeating Portimonense 6-1 over the weekend in the Primeira Liga. Expect a laser-like Real Madrid team, however, since victory guarantees a berth in the knockout stages. Sutton is taking under 3.5 goals for a -115 payoff in Real Madrid vs. Braga. Real Madrid won 2-1 despite not exhibiting any sign of dominance in the rematch. In the match, Braga actually outshot Real Madrid 16–13, yet Los Blancos controlled 52% of the possession.

Only three of those attempts were on goal, however, and Real Madrid’s defensive consistency has been a strength this season. This season, in 15 games in all competitions, the Spanish powerhouses have only let up 11 goals while keeping seven clean sheets.

There have only been four Real Madrid games this season when four goals or more have been scored in total. The previous four Real Madrid games have ended in under 3.5 goals.
